This position is posted by Jobgether on behalf of a partner company. We are currently looking for a Senior Product Manager, CRM in Canada.

Join a fast-growing SaaS environment where product innovation, customer insight, and AI-driven experiences come together to transform how professionals manage and grow critical business relationships. In this high-impact role, you will own key CRM capabilities used daily by customers, shaping both the strategic vision and execution of product initiatives. You’ll collaborate closely with engineering, design, customer-facing teams, and leadership to deliver intuitive, scalable solutions that solve complex user challenges. This position offers the opportunity to influence a mature product while driving the next generation of AI-powered workflows and automation. Ideal for a strategic thinker with strong execution skills, this role combines customer empathy, analytical decision-making, and cross-functional leadership in a collaborative and growth-oriented environment.

Accountabilities:

  • Define and execute the product roadmap for core CRM capabilities, aligning business objectives, customer needs, and long-term product strategy.
  • Conduct customer research, analyze product usage data, and gather stakeholder feedback to identify opportunities for innovation and improvement.
  • Lead the full product lifecycle, from discovery and requirements definition through design, development, testing, launch, and ongoing optimization.
  • Collaborate closely with engineering and design teams to prioritize initiatives, maintain product backlogs, and deliver high-quality user experiences.
  • Develop business cases, success metrics, and ROI frameworks to support strategic product investments and roadmap decisions.
  • Drive modernization initiatives and platform enhancements while maintaining continuity and usability for existing customers.
  • Identify opportunities to integrate AI-powered capabilities into CRM workflows, improving automation, intelligence, and user productivity.
  • Partner with sales, customer success, marketing, and leadership teams to ensure alignment on product goals, launches, and customer outcomes.
  • Monitor product performance, customer feedback, and market trends to continuously refine priorities and maximize business impact.
  • Contribute to a culture of innovation, collaboration, experimentation, and continuous improvement across the product organization.
  • Requirements

    • 5+ years of product management experience within SaaS or enterprise software environments.
    • Proven experience leading cross-functional teams through the end-to-end product development lifecycle.
    • Strong track record of delivering measurable business outcomes through customer-focused product strategies.
    • Experience managing complex products, platform transformations, migrations, or modernization initiatives.
    • Deep understanding of user-centered design principles and the ability to simplify complex workflows.
    • Strong analytical skills with experience using customer insights, data, and experimentation to drive decisions.
    • Demonstrated ability to prioritize competing initiatives and navigate ambiguity in fast-paced environments.
    • Excellent communication, stakeholder management, and collaboration skills across technical and non-technical audiences.
    • Experience evaluating or implementing AI-powered product capabilities, automation workflows, or AI-enhanced user experiences.
    • Strong strategic thinking, problem-solving abilities, and a passion for building impactful products that deliver customer value.
    • Benefits

      • Competitive base salary ranging from CAD $152,000 to $190,000, based on experience and qualifications.
      • Equity participation opportunities in addition to base compensation.
      • Comprehensive extended health coverage for employees and eligible dependents.
      • Flexible personal and sick leave policies supporting work-life balance.
      • RRSP retirement savings program.
      • Annual learning and development budget to support professional growth and career advancement.
      • Comprehensive training and development programs.
      • Monthly reimbursements for home internet, wellness memberships, meals, and related expenses.
      • Virtual team-building activities, social events, and opportunities to connect with colleagues across the organization.
      • Flexible, collaborative, and growth-oriented work environment focused on innovation and continuous learning.
